Aamir Khan Shares New Look Of Home Production Secret Superstar

IANS, 31 Jul, 2017 01:00 PM

    Aamir Khan today treated his fans with a fresh poster of his home production 'Secret Superstar'.

     

    The ' Dangal' star took to Twitter to share the new look where Zaira Wasim is seen walking on a bridge wearing a school uniform and carrying a backpack.

     

    The tagline of the film reads, "Dream Dekhna Toh Basic Hota Hai"

     
     

    The poster also announces that the trailer of the film will be out on August 2. ' Secret Superstar' is a musical drama film, written and directed by the star's former manager Advait Chandan and produced by Aamir and his wife Kiran Rao.

     

    The flick is set to have a box office clash with Rohit Shetty's ' Golmaal Again' on Diwali, thsi year.
